Biogeography-based Optimization for the Traveling Salesman Problems
Biogeography-based optimization (BBO) is a novel evolutionary algorithm that is based on the mathematics of biogeography. In the BBO model, problem solutions are represented as islands, and the sharing of features between solutions is represented as immigration and emigration between the islands. This paper generalizes an application of the BBO algorithm to the traveling salesman problems. The BBO solution is compared with the solution of the same problem using the genetic algorithms (GA). The results of simulation indicate that BBO algorithm performs better than the GA in determining an optimal solution of the traveling salesman problems.
